創世記 42:24

KJV

And he turned himself about from them, and wept; and returned to them again, and communed with them, and took from them Simeon, and bound him before their eyes.

— 創世記 42:24, King James Version

Context

This verse from 創世記 Chapter 42 connects to 10 cross-references. 飢饉のため、ヤコブの息子たちはエジプトへ食糧を買いに来た。ヨセフは彼らを見知ったが、兄弟たちは彼に気づかなかった。ヨセフは彼らを試し、シメオンを人質にしてベニヤミンを連れてくるよう命じた。

他の翻訳

ASV

And he turned himself about from them, and wept; and he returned to them, and spake to them, and took Simeon from among them, and bound him before their eyes.

YLT

and he turneth round from them, and weepeth, and turneth back unto them, and speaketh unto them, and taketh from them Simeon, and bindeth him before their eyes.

BBE

And turning away from them, he was overcome with weeping; then he went on talking to them again and took Simeon and put chains on him before their eyes.
